KARACHI: The NAP chief, Khan Abdul Wali Khan, said in Karachi yesterday [May 30] that the “adventure in Baluchistan,” if allowed to go unchecked, would doom the country. He was addressing a Press conference. …

He observed that the greatest conspiracy Pakistan has suffered from, is the conspiracy of silence and hoped that, unlike East Pakistan, people of Baluchistan will not be left alone in their fight for supremacy of law and constitutionalism. He wondered how Nawab Akbar Khan Bugti, who had been openly pleading for confederation with India and Bangladesh, is allowed to preside over the destiny of an important Pakistani province. — News agencies

[Meanwhile, as reported by news agencies from Karachi,] Pir Pagaro disclosed to a hurriedly called Press conference last night that a plot to assassinate him and members of his family had been drawn up. The United Democratic Front (UDF) President named a present and former Minister of Sind as the creators of the alleged conspiracy and said he had come to know of their plans through their own people. The first plot, hatched by a present Sind Minister, had been revealed to him by a person whom he had seen for the first time. … Mr Rahim Baksh Soomro, a Sind MPA, disclosed to him the second plot. …
